Cell Refinement & Pattern Indexing

The cell parameters of crystalline substances are determined or refined. The module is able to separate and index the individual crystalline phases from measurements of substance mixtures.
The measured interferences are indexed according to crystal classes, lattice parameters and extinction rules.
As an example you can see this application on the measurement data of a technical anatase (TiO2).

Crystallite size and Microstress

nThe grains of a powdered material are themselves composed of smaller polycrystalline crystallites. They determine the physical properties of the material.

The size and residual stress of these crystallites can be easily determined in ADM Suite.

Using the example of a tungsten powder, the grain size of which the manufacturer specifies as < 10 µ, the crystallite size is determined to be 256.6 ± 6.6 Å (25.7 ± 0.7 nm) and a negligible internal stress (microstress) of 0.067 ± 0.005%:

Only in ADM: Isoangular sections

The option to make isoangular sections is a unique selling point of the ADM software package. It gives the user the option of displaying intensities at the same diffraction angles from different diffractograms. This enables a visual representation of the intensity curve of identical interferences in several diffractograms and thus increases the efficiency in the analysis of material samples.

One application is the analysis of multiple components in a substance at different temperatures to follow reactions. The following 3D representation shows several diffractograms at synthesis temperatures between 600 and 640 degrees Celsius, which contain the quartz, calcite and wollastonite phases. The formation reaction of wollastonite from calcite and quartz  can be seen very well in the isoangular section (second image).

In the isoangular sections , the transformation of the phases can be seen very well (point of intersection):

Phase analysis of a riverbank sand

The Iller flows directly in front of the RMSKempten laboratory. In addition to water, the Iller transports large amounts of sediment from the Alps downstream. These are stored on the shore along the river as sand.

Our XRD tells us what this sand is made of:
